In this tutorial I will show you how to create a simple but beautiful header. After all, it takes just a bit of time and effort to make unique header so there is no real reason to use generic one for your blog, forum or website when you can make your own just the way you want it to be.

Here, let me show you just how easy and simple making header can be.

Step 4

Now let’s make some clouds. Make a new layer. Choose a color for the foreground. Mine is #d8f1f5.

Step 5

Go to Shape Tool and from there choose Ellipse Tool:

Step 6

Switch to Shape Layers:

Now hold down Shift, draw a circle, press the Add to path area and add 3-4 circles more, overlapping each other a bit.


Step 7

Now press right click and Rasterize layer.

Step 8

Step 9

Make a new layer, go to Shape Tool and this time choose Line Tool. Draw a box using whatever color you want.

Step 10

For the next step grab the Pen Tool and draw some wavy lines, each one in separate layer and with different color.

Step 11

Make the wavy line:

Step 12

Press right click and select Stroke Path:

Step 13

You can check Simulate Pressure or not, try both ways and see what's best for you.
Select Brush from the drop down menu and make sure a soft brush is selected (you can select it from the Brush Tool).
Then apply shadow using Layer Style. Order the lines as if they are coming out of the box.

Step 14

If you don't want to do the same move 4 times (double click – drop shadow and select the value) you can make the settings for the first line and then just right click and select Copy layer style and Paste layer style to the next layer that you want to have the same settings.



But in our case we still have to change the color of the shadow.

Step 15

Now go to your Brush Tool and select brush with stars. Apply some on your design and that's all!
